Superstars may lead the discussion when it comes to success in the NFL, but more often than not, it’s the guys you barely know who will make the plays needed when they’re needed.

Take the Super Bowl champion Philadelphia Eagles, for example. They signed linebacker Zack Baun to a one-year, $3.5 million contract before the 2024 season. The former New Orleans Saint seemed destined to have a career in which he was a rotational linebacker at best, and a special-teams demon to fill things out. But defensive coordinator Vic Fangio saw something in Baun — something which told him that Baun could be the epicenter of his defense.

And that’s exactly what happened. Baun was a revelation in Fangio’s schemes, signed a three-year, $51 million contract with $34 million guaranteed to go along with his shiny Super Bowl ring, and he’s no longer a Secret Superstar, because the secret is out.

So, in the Eagles’ case, it’s time to look ahead, and that’s true of every NFL team — which is why I took the “Secret Superstars” articles I wrote every week in the 2024 season, and spun the concept forward in the “Hidden Gems” series that point out three underrated players for every team — one underrated veteran, one underrated free-agent signing, and one underrated draft pick. We fill out the picture with metrics, tape examples, and quotes from coaches, teammates, and the Hidden Gems themselves.
